A lot of what factors into the overall cost of renting a dumpster can be attributed to location. These costs include:

  • The distance from our facility to the job and then to the landfill
  • The overall fuel cost to fill up trucks
  • The price the landfill charges to dump waste (differs by city or county)
  • City and state waste and recycling laws

Additionally, the type of debris plays a large role in the cost of dumpster rentals. For example, construction materials, such as concrete, may need to be disposed of in a separate location than everyday trash.
